Refractory bricks are a type of material that can withstand high temperatures and are used in a variety of industrial applications. They are made from a combination of clay, alumina, and other materials that are designed to resist heat and wear.
Refractory bricks are used in a variety of industries, including the steel, cement, and glass industries. They are used to line furnaces, kilns, and other high-temperature equipment, and are designed to withstand the extreme temperatures and harsh conditions found in these environments.

There are several types of refractory bricks, each with its own unique properties and applications.
Fireclay bricks are made from a mixture of clay and other materials, and are designed to withstand temperatures up to 1,500 degrees Celsius. They are commonly used to line furnaces, kilns, and other high-temperature equipment.
High alumina bricks are made from a mixture of alumina and other materials, and are designed to withstand temperatures up to 1,800 degrees Celsius. They are commonly used in the steel and cement industries.
Silica bricks are made from a mixture of silica and other materials, and are designed to withstand temperatures up to 1,600 degrees Celsius. They are commonly used in the glass industry.
Magnesia bricks are made from a mixture of magnesia and other materials, and are designed to withstand temperatures up to 1,800 degrees Celsius. They are commonly used in the steel and cement industries.
Zircon bricks are made from a mixture of zircon and other materials, and are designed to withstand temperatures up to 1,900 degrees Celsius. They are commonly used in the glass and ceramics industries.
